Ingredients Needed:
Protein:
- 2 chicken breasts
Spices:
- 2 tablespoons taco seasoning
Tortillas:
- 8 corn tortillas
Toppings:
- 1 small onion, chopped
- ½ cup fresh cilantro, chopped
- 2 limes, cut into wedges

Step-by-Step Instructions:
- In a bowl, marinate the chicken breasts with taco seasoning, ensuring they’re well-coated.
- Grill the chicken over medium heat for about 6-7 minutes per side or until cooked through and the juices run clear.
- Warm the corn tortillas on the grill for about 1 minute on each side or until soft.
- Once the chicken is done, slice it into thin strips and place inside the warmed tortillas.
- Top with chopped onion, fresh cilantro, and a generous squeeze of lime juice.
- Serve immediately and enjoy the delicious flavors!

Tips for Success with Chicken Street Tacos
- Marination Time: For enhanced flavor, let the chicken marinate for at least 30 minutes or even overnight.
- Grilling Tips: Make sure your grill is preheated for even cooking and to achieve those perfect grill marks.
- Tortilla Warming: If you don’t have a grill, you can warm the tortillas in a dry skillet over medium heat for a few seconds on each side.
- Chicken Alternatives: Feel free to substitute chicken with beef, shrimp, or even grilled vegetables for a different twist.
- Freshness Matters: Use fresh ingredients for toppings to elevate the flavor of your tacos.
Variations
- Spicy Option: Add sliced jalapeños or a chipotle sauce for an extra kick.
- Vegetarian Version: Replace chicken with grilled portobello mushrooms or sautéed zucchini for a delicious meatless alternative.

FAQs
- Can I freeze the chicken after marinating? Yes, marinated chicken can be frozen for up to 2 months. Just thaw it in the fridge before grilling!
- What can I use instead of corn tortillas? Flour tortillas or lettuce wraps can be a great substitute if you prefer.
- How can I make the tacos healthier? Opt for grilled chicken with light taco seasoning and load up on fresh veggies for toppings.
